My Gastric Sleeve surgery was performed by Dr. Alvarez, and his team on July 31, 2009, in Piedras Negras, Mexico. At first, I was leary of leaving the United States to seek an operation in a foreign land. But, from the time they picked me up in San Antonio, drove me to Eagle Pass, Tx., checked me into the hotel, and took me across the border into Piedras Negras, to meet Dr. Alvarez, everything was so organized, and the itenerary followed to the minute, I was immediately put at ease. Meeting Dr. Alvarez was a real pleasure. He went over my paperwork, asked me my goals, and answered every question I had. He explained the entire procedure, and told me what to expect post-surgery. His office was modern, clean, hi-tech, and comfortable. I was then turned over to his staff who checked me into the hospital next door. The room was well air-conditioned, modern, had cable tv, internet, and bathroom, much like a hotel room. I had a chest X-Ray, some blood drawn, and then met with the anesthesiolist. The anesthesiologist gave me a shot and the next thing I knew I was being awakened by Dr. Alvarez, who told me the surgery went great. There was never any pain, just some discomfort from the gas in my stomach. The nurses at the hospital were exceptionally nice and attentive to every need. They checked blood pressure, blood sugar, temperature, several times each day. Dr. Alvarez saw me several times and checked for the sounds my new stomach made, and continued to answer any questions I had. I had never been in a hospital before, so I didn't like the IV much, but they took it out on the morning of day two. The first night post-surgery was tough getting much sleep, but the second night I slept very well, and the next morning I met with Dr. Alvarez again, had a leak test and given some medicine in case of gas, pain, and antibiotics. I was then discharged by 8:30 AM and was on my way back across the border, and then to San Antonio, and was checked in to the hotel by 11:30 AM. I took a bus to the San Antonio Riverwalk, and done some souvenir shopping. The entire experience and the way I was treated is something I will always remember. I am sure I could not have found better treatment in the U.S. It is now six weeks later, I have lost 30 lbs., and have been able to stop my Type II Diabetes medication as my blood sugar has normalized. Amazing experience. Dr. Alvarez and his staff are the best in the business for this type surgery and I give them a 10 on a scale of 1 to 10.

I'm 4 weeks out from my VSG by Dr. Alvarez and couldn't be more pleased. The entire experience was just as promised.rnrnAs a physician myself, I'm very picky about who I let care for me. I thoroughly researched all my options before choosing my physician. Dr. Alvarez immediately inspired my confidence. He speaks english with almost no accent, and took his time to answer my and my wife's questions.rnrnThe facility is extremely clean, and the service was excellent. My hospital room even had a computer, and a phone outside to make free calls to the US. The nurses were all very nice and checked on me frequently.rnrnSurgery went off as planned, and the discomfort after surgery was promptly relieved with pain meds. The next day, I was already walking around the hospital and the minimal discomfort I experienced was relieved without even using narcotics.rnrnDr. Alvarez checked on me quite frequently, and took his time to make sure I was comfortable and all questions answered. I had very clear instructions on aftercare, including wound care, diet, meds etc.rnrnI spent 2 nights in the hospital after surgery, one night in a hotel, and was on my way back home. The hardest part was the first week. Clear liquids only is difficult. I got very tired of gatorade! I never thought chicken/beef broth could taste so good.rnrnSince then I've lost 22lbs. The weird thing is food that I used to love (pizza, burgers) don't appeal at all now. Dr. Alvarez says it is because my ghrelin levels have gone down. I am so glad I don't have to fight those irresistible urges anymore.rnrnIf you are considering VSG, I don't think you could do better than Dr. Alvarez and his team.
